Cardiovascular effects of (R)- and (S)-verapamil and racemic verapamil in humans: a placebo-controlled study

To characterise the comparative potency of optically pure (R)- and (S)-verapamil as regards negative dromotropic effects on atrioventricular (AV) node conduction and to compare the hemodynamic effects of single doses of the enantiomers in healthy volunteers.
